#CCDBF4 Color Information

Hex color code: #CCDBF4

#CCDBF4 is a soft blue color. In RGB it is (204, 219, 244), and in HSL it is (218°, 65%, 88%). It is often used for branding and logos.

Color Meaning and Usage

A soft blue tone, #CCDBF4 has RGB (204, 219, 244) and HSL (218°, 65%, 88%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is often used for buttons, highlights, and accents.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#CCDBF4 is #F4E6CD,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#CDEFF4.
